In some circumstances, many teeth may overlap one another. While braces may be appropriate in such circumstances, porcelain crowns can just as simply cure the problem and create a pleasant smile. For example, if all of the teeth are reasonably straight and only one is crooked, it’s simple to choose a crown over braces. Dentists who use digital impression scanners to scan your teeth can email your impressions to the dental lab where your crowns are made. This speeds up the procedure, requiring you to wear your temporary crowns for a shorter period of time. Some dentists produce dental crowns in their clinics; in such circumstances, several appointments are not required.

It's natural to want to know how long braces will take to straighten your teeth, but there is no simple answer. Treatment can be over in 3-6 months if you only need mild correction. An example of this is if you only need to straighten your front teeth, or a couple of bottom teeth. For more severe cases, treatment can take two years or more.
